How to see it
HIP 37352 has a visual magnitude of about 8.95: it is a telescope star and remains difficult or invisible to the naked eye even in good conditions.
Sky position
Equatorial coordinates for HIP 37352: right ascension 7h 40m 1s, declination +2° 6′ 1″ (J2000), in the region of the Canis Minor constellation (IAU figure CMi).
